M0979 - Fluorescein-5(6)-carboxamidocaproic acid N-hydroxysuccinimidyl ester
(6-[Fluorescein-5(6)-carboxamido]hexanoic acid-N-hydroxysuccinimide ester)


Molecular Weight: 586.55

Storage: F, D, L

[C=Cold D=Desiccated F=Frozen L=Light Sensitive RT=Room Temperature]

Soluble: MeOH, DMF, DMSO

Absorption: (in nm) 491

Emission: (in nm) 515

Molecular Formula: C31H26N2O10

CAS Number: [114616-31-8]

Alternative Name: 6-[Fluorescein-5(6)-carboxamido]hexanoic acid-N-hydroxysuccinimide ester

Description:
Useful fluorescent amine-reactive probe has an added spacer to improve accessibility of the reactive group by nucleophiles in preparation of bioconjugates.

Note:
Emission and Absorption rates are in pH 9
